Study rules

The subject-specific provisions (FSB) specify the course of studies as well as the prerequisite for admission to the assessments and the assessment standards. The FSB include the list of modules (SFB) as an annex. They regulate:

  • Qualification requirements for the respective degree programme
  • Listing of modules to be taken (SFB)
  • Requirements and methods of assessment
  • Number of study semesters after which the university degree can generally be obtained (standard length of programme) or has to be obtained (maximum length of programme) and the required coursework
  • Determination of the overall grade
  • Awarded academic degree after successful completion

The list of modules (SFB) of a degree programme is the annex to the FSB. The SFB includes:

  • Listing of modules and module components that have to be taken in the individual fields or sub-fields of a degree programme
  • Requirements and methods of assessment

The list of modules is the most important and central document for students and prospective students.

The study plan (SVP) provides guidance for a time-coordinated course of study. It presents a specific proposal of how to be able to complete the studies within standard length. Information of the SVP does not supersede information of the SFB. More particularly, the SVP does not contain possible options for an alternative course of studies and only sparse information about the structure of the degree programme and individual assessments.
